CONCERT REVIEW: LANDMVRKS Amaze During Ecstatic Tilburg Show

Last weekend, the city of Tilburg hosted a total of 2 epic, sold-out shows in Poppodium 013 on Saturday night. In the main hall, popular soul artist Teddy Swims performed in front of a sold-out crowd, and in the smaller Next stage, an insane metalcore package brought together by headliner LANDMVRKS blew fans away. Unfortunately, we were only able to capture metalcore giants The Devil Wears Prada, who set the bar exceptionally high and the aforementioned LANDMVRKS.

The Devil Wears Prada, known for their insanely high-energy performances were on top of their game, as they have been for years. With a setlist more catered towards their most recent work, The Devil Wears Prada truly showed what they are made of and why they are the household name in the metalcore scene. Musically and interactively, The Devil Wears Prada drew the biggest possible pits, with one crowdsurfer after the other. They are a force to be reckoned with.

For us it was the very first time seeing LANDMVRKS, so we had no idea what to expect of their live performance. As fans of their music, we were excited to finally witness the band live but had no idea what kind of show the French metalcore band are capable of. Luckily, this question was answered within the first few minutes of their performance. Kicking things off with the most recent single Creature, the tone was set for the entire evening. High energy, a lot of interaction and a unique screen in the form of the letter V to compliment the band’s performance with a splash of digital colour.

The audience was completely engaged, singing along to every word and moshing to the powerful beats. LANDMVRKS‘ interaction with the crowd was genuine and heartfelt, creating an intimate atmosphere amidst the sprawling venue. The sound quality was impeccable, with each note resonating clearly, ensuring that the intricacies of their music were fully appreciated.
